Method

Prepare the Burger Patty

  1. 1

    Form the Patties

    Divide the ground beef into four equal portions (4 oz each). Gently form each portion into a ball without overworking the meat.

  2. 2

    Season the Patties

    Sprinkle each ball with salt and black pepper on all sides.

Cook the Burger

  1. 3

    Heat the Grill or Skillet

    Preheat a grill or a skillet over medium-high heat for about 5 minutes.

  2. 4

    Sear the Burgers

    Place the beef balls on the hot grill or skillet. Using a spatula, smash each ball down into a patty about 1/2 inch thick. Cook for about 2-3 minutes until a crust forms.

  3. 5

    Add Cheese

    Flip the patties and place a slice of American cheese on top of each patty. Cook for an additional 1-2 minutes until the cheese is melted.

Toast the Buns

  1. 6

    Butter the Buns

    Spread butter on the cut sides of each brioche bun.

  2. 7

    Toast the Buns

    Place the buns, buttered side down, on the grill or skillet for about 1-2 minutes until golden brown.

Assemble the Burgers

  1. 8

    Build the Burger

    Place each cheesy burger patty on the bottom half of a toasted brioche bun. Top with the other half of the bun.

  2. 9

    Serve

    Serve the kid's cheese smash burgers warm with optional sides like fries or veggies.
